About Maxie's Campground
What sets Maxie’s Campground apart is the seamless blend of convenience and charm, offering a quiet retreat shaded by majestic Live Oak trees while being just off US 90 in Broussard, Louisiana. This RV-friendly campground is celebrated for its full-service amenities, strategic location, and serene ambiance, making it a versatile choice for relaxed stopovers or extended stays.
Established in 1968, the campground features 70 full-hookup sites with 20, 30, and 50-amp services, clean restrooms, hot showers, and a remodeled laundry facility. Most sites include picnic tables, ensuring comfort for RVers and families alike. Guests can unwind in this meticulously maintained environment, with notable accessibility to pet-friendly spaces and complimentary WiFi. While the campground is conveniently near the highway, the lush canopy of Live Oaks creates a tranquil setting that cushions campers from road noise.
Located next door to Arceneaux Park and just minutes from St. Julien Park, the campground provides easy access to recreational activities. Within a 15-minute drive, visitors can explore the cultural richness of Vermilionville Historic Village, the serene beauty of Jungle Gardens on Avery Island, and the vibrant local wildlife at Zoosiana. Maxie’s Campground acts as a gateway to Cajun Country’s distinctive flavor and natural beauty, making it ideal for families, history buffs, and those seeking a taste of Louisiana’s heritage.
